From cca439a931d5e0640fc3b04599a3232bfcd6d100 Mon Sep 17 00:00:00 2001 From: Sean Breckenridge Date: Mon, 25 Apr 2022 20:30:23 -0700 Subject: [PATCH] check required accuracy when computing timezones --- my/time/tz/via_location.py | 2 ++ 1 file changed, 2 insertions(+) diff --git a/my/time/tz/via_location.py b/my/time/tz/via_location.py index 397c9ac..8d290b9 100644 --- a/my/time/tz/via_location.py +++ b/my/time/tz/via_location.py @@ -60,6 +60,8 @@ def _locations() -> Iterator[Tuple[LatLon, datetime]]: try: import my.location.all for loc in my.location.all.locations(): + if loc.accuracy is not None and loc.accuracy > config.require_accuracy: + continue yield ((loc.lat, loc.lon), loc.dt) except Exception as e: